Log:
  ln: Allow a trailing slash when creating a link to a directory.
  
  In the 'ln source... directory' synopsis, the basename of each source
  determines the name of the created link. Determine this using basename(3)
  instead of strrchr(..., '/') which is incorrect if the pathname ends in a
  slash.
  
  The patch is somewhat changed to allow for basename(3) implementations that
  change the passed pathname, and to fix the -w option's checking also.
  The code to compare directory entries only applies to hard links, which
  cannot be created to directories using ln.
  
  Example:
    ln -s /etc/defaults/ /tmp
  This should create a symlink named defaults.

Modified:
  head/bin/ln/ln.c

Modified: head/bin/ln/ln.c
==============================================================================
--- head/bin/ln/ln.c    Wed Apr 21 21:51:14 2010        (r207020)
+++ head/bin/ln/ln.c    Wed Apr 21 21:57:03 2010        (r207021)
@@ -47,6 +47,7 @@ __FBSDID("$FreeBSD$");
 #include <err.h>
 #include <errno.h>
 #include <fcntl.h>
+#include <libgen.h>
 #include <limits.h>
 #include <stdio.h>
 #include <stdlib.h>
@@ -226,6 +227,7 @@ linkit(const char *source, const char *t
        int ch, exists, first;
        char path[PATH_MAX];
        char wbuf[PATH_MAX];
+       char bbuf[PATH_MAX];
 
        if (!sflag) {
                /* If source doesn't exist, quit now. */
@@ -248,11 +250,9 @@ linkit(const char *source, const char *t
        if (isdir ||
            (lstat(target, &sb) == 0 && S_ISDIR(sb.st_mode)) ||
            (!hflag && stat(target, &sb) == 0 && S_ISDIR(sb.st_mode))) {
-               if ((p = strrchr(source, '/')) == NULL)
-                       p = source;
-               else
-                       ++p;
-               if (snprintf(path, sizeof(path), "%s/%s", target, p) >=
+               if (strlcpy(bbuf, source, sizeof(bbuf)) >= sizeof(bbuf) ||
+                   (p = basename(bbuf)) == NULL ||
+                   snprintf(path, sizeof(path), "%s/%s", target, p) >=
                    (ssize_t)sizeof(path)) {
                        errno = ENAMETOOLONG;
                        warn("%s", source);
@@ -276,15 +276,14 @@ linkit(const char *source, const char *t
                         * absolute path of the source, by appending `source'
                         * to the parent directory of the target.
                         */
-                       p = strrchr(target, '/');
-                       if (p != NULL)
-                               p++;
-                       else
-                               p = target;
-                       (void)snprintf(wbuf, sizeof(wbuf), "%.*s%s",
-                           (int)(p - target), target, source);
-                       if (stat(wbuf, &sb) != 0)
-                               warn("warning: %s", source);
+                       strlcpy(bbuf, target, sizeof(bbuf));
+                       p = dirname(bbuf);
+                       if (p != NULL) {
+                               (void)snprintf(wbuf, sizeof(wbuf), "%s/%s",
+                                               p, source);
+                               if (stat(wbuf, &sb) != 0)
+                                       warn("warning: %s", source);
+                       }
                }
        }
